An issue was discovered in through SaltStack Salt before 3002.5. The jinja renderer does not protect against server side template injection attacks.

Technical summary Written by usOur analysis, written from the advisory, the CVSS vector and the affected-version data. It adds context the advisory leaves out, and never invents facts that are not in the source.

dbcve analysis · high confidence

The Jinja renderer in SaltStack Salt versions before 3002.5 lacks protection against server-side template injection (SSTI), enabling remote attackers to inject and execute malicious Jinja template code server-side, potentially achieving remote code execution.

MitigationUpgrade SaltStack Salt to version 3002.5 or later which implements proper safeguards in the Jinja renderer to prevent template injection attacks.

  1. Check if SaltStack Salt is installed
    Run `salt --version` or `salt-minion --version` to identify the installed Salt version
    Affected if Salt is installed and the version falls within the affected ranges: < 2015.8.10, >= 2015.8.11 and < 2015.8.13, >= 2016.3.0 and < 2016.3.4, >= 2016.3.5 and < 2016.3.6, >= 2016.3.7 and < 2016.3.8, >= 2016.3.9 and < 2016.11.3, >= 2016.11.4 and < 2016.11.5, >= 2016.11.7 and < 2016.11.10, >= 2017.5.0 and
  2. Verify the salt-master service exposure
    Check network configuration to determine if the salt-master service (default port 4506) is listening on interfaces accessible from untrusted networks
    Affected if The salt-master is exposed to untrusted or public networks, allowing remote attackers to send malicious Jinja template payloads
  3. Confirm Jinja template rendering is in use
    Review Salt configuration files (master config at /etc/salt/master or minion config at /etc/salt/minion) to confirm template rendering is enabled, which is enabled by default in Salt
    Affected if Jinja template rendering is active, which is the default state for Salt installations and is required for the vulnerability to be exploitable
  4. Check for recent authentication activity
    Review salt-master logs for unusual Jinja template requests or authentication attempts from untrusted sources in /var/log/salt/master or equivalent log location
    Affected if There are log entries indicating Jinja template injection attempts or unexpected template rendering requests

Your environment is affected if SaltStack Salt is installed with a version below 3002.5 and the salt-master service is accessible to untrusted networks where attackers could inject malicious Jinja template code.
